one thing I see not addressed .. spring wire size,, since these springs are not progressive the spring rate does not increase as they get compressed more, the thicker the wire size on the spring the higher the spring rate , since a cr500 uses 6 springs and a 250r has 5 there isn't much difference in a single spring as far as spring rate goes ,